We’ve had a wonderful spring so far. Plenty of soft rains (and occasional monsoon downpours), gentle breezes (with a slight chance of tornadoes), and lots of sunshine (frequently covered up by thick clouds). All-in-all a typical Ohio springtime. The best part of the spring is the wealth of flowering trees, bushes, shrubs, and bulbs.
This year our dogwood tree came out with tons of blooms. When we planted it, I chose a red flower instead of the traditional white flower, just to have some different color on that side of the house. Right now, we have lot of pinks blossoms blowing in the breeze. The tree itself is not very big and grows slowly, so I’m hoping for years of blossoms each spring.
This image was a fun one to capture. The breeze was blowing and the flower kept waving in the breeze. I’m trying out my new macro lens to get closer and more detail.
